Why Heavy Equipment Requires Custom Fasteners Instead of Standard Parts
Standard fasteners are designed for general applications, but heavy equipment introduces unique constraints.
In practice, engineers often face three core limitations:
- Non-standard dimensions that do not match catalog products
- Higher load requirements beyond standard strength grades
- Limited installation space requires special designs
Custom fasteners address these issues by aligning directly with equipment structure and load conditions.
Instead of adapting the design to fit standard parts, manufacturers can design the fastener to fit the application. This improves assembly accuracy and reduces the risk of long-term failure.
Key Challenges in Heavy Equipment Fastening: Load, Vibration, and Wear
Fastening systems in heavy equipment must perform under combined stress factors rather than a single condition.
The most critical challenges include:
- High load – continuous stress requires stable tensile strength
- Vibration – dynamic operation increases the risk of loosening
- Wear and environment – dust, moisture, and temperature accelerate degradation
These factors often act simultaneously, making fastening performance more complex than in standard industrial applications.
To ensure reliability, fasteners must be engineered with appropriate material selection, preload control, and surface protection.
Custom Fastener Solutions for Excavators, Mining, and Construction Machinery
Different types of heavy equipment require different fastening strategies.
In construction machinery such as excavators, fasteners are used in structural joints that must maintain preload under repeated movement.
Mining equipment operates in more aggressive environments. Fasteners must resist impact, abrasion, and continuous vibration while maintaining mechanical integrity.
For specialized equipment, custom fasteners are often designed with:
- Non-standard lengths or diameters
- Special head structures for installation constraints
- Optimized thread design for load distribution
These tailored solutions help improve equipment reliability while reducing maintenance frequency.
Material Selection and Strength Grades for Heavy-Duty Fasteners
Material selection is a key factor in fastener performance.
The choice typically depends on three considerations:
- Required strength level
- Operating environment
- Expected service life
Carbon steel is commonly used for high-strength applications due to its balance of performance and cost. Alloy steel is preferred when higher strength and fatigue resistance are required.
For environments with high humidity or exposure, corrosion resistance becomes critical, and appropriate coatings or stainless materials may be used.
Heat treatment is carefully controlled to achieve the desired mechanical properties while maintaining material stability.
Precision Manufacturing and Quality Control for Critical Applications
Even with correct design and material selection, performance depends on manufacturing precision.
Key processes include cold heading, CNC machining, and thread rolling. Each process is selected based on product complexity and tolerance requirements.
During production, several critical checkpoints ensure consistency:
- Dimensional accuracy of shank and threads
- Surface condition and coating quality
- Mechanical performance verification
Thread rolling plays a particularly important role, as it improves fatigue resistance while maintaining precise geometry.
Consistent quality control ensures that every batch performs the same in real applications.
